This is a replacement ice maker assembly kit for refrigerators. The ice maker is responsible for several different functions. It catches water from the inlet valve and holds it while it freezes into ice cubes. When the cubes are frozen, the ice maker rotates and the cubes dump into the tray below. Ice makers include a number of moving parts and can suffer from significant wear and tear over time. Eventually, gears will wear down, electrical contacts may corrode, and the entire assembly will need to be replaced. Signs the ice maker needs to be replaced include water leaking into the ice tray and no ice being made. Replacing the ice maker assembly will require unplugging the refrigerator, turning off the water, and accessing the freezer. Disconnect the water line, then locate the mounting screws and remove them. Remove the old ice maker and replace it with the new one.This is a genuine OEM part manufactured by LG. The old filter head was broken at the supply line side connector fell out. The clicking noise eventually caused the fridge to warm up and stop cooling. The clicking was the overload relay tripping. The Start solenoid on the compressor was an Embarco TSD part 513604044. APP does not have that part nor does any else found a similar one on ebay but I ordered the PTC assembly 6749C-0014E.
